Second, when you go to the dentist you want to make sure that you are honest with your reasons for being there. Explain that you have been grinding your teeth at night and that you would like him or her to help you stop.
More than likely, the dentist will create a custom mouthpiece for you. This is a mouthpiece that you will have to wear at night and it will make sure that you are able to decrease your ability to grind your teeth.
There are a lot of people that have a hard time understanding how important it is to remember their mouth piece. You should be sure that you take the time that you need to make your mouth piece a part of your daily routine.
This way, when you go to bed you will not even have to think twice about putting your mouth guard in. When you are good at putting your mouth guard in on a consistent basis you will be able to be sure that you minimize the effect of your teeth grinding problem.
Third, when you visit your dentist you may also want to be sure that he or she files down any high spots on your teeth. When you have high spots they may interfere with your ability to bite down correctly.
When these high spots mess with your alignment they can become a problem. If the doctor does not think that any filing is necessary you may want to find a second opinion just so you can be sure that your teeth are being taken care of well.
Fourth, before you go to bed at night you want to figure out how you can relax your jaw muscles. There are a lot of people that have a hard time understanding how important this can be and what a difference it can make.
When you hold a warm damp cloth next to your face before you go to bed you may find that you are able to calm down those muscles. You should take the time that you need to hold the cloth next to your face until you feel them relax.
After you start to feel the muscles relax you can take the cloth off of your face. To relax your entire body you may want to stretch, meditate or you may even want to climb into a hot bath before you get into bed.
Learning how you are going to deal with your stress and reduce stress levels in your life will also make a big difference. The less stress that you are dealing with on a daily basis the easier it will be to minimize the amount of teeth grinding that you do.
